Cyclacel Pharmaceuticals (CYCC): Two weeks ago brokerage and investment bank Piper Jaffray reported that Cyclacel Pharmaceuticals would likely report positive data during the Annual Meeting of the American Society of Clinical Oncology (ASCO). Cyclacel’s key drug is ‘Sapacitabine’ which is currently being testing for Acute Myelogenous Leukemia, which is commonly referred to as AML and accounts for 1.2% of all cancer deaths in the United States. Sapacitabine is also being testing in patients who have myelodysplastic syndrome, commonly referred to as MDS. The data from these two drugs alone has been extremely positive: in early February Cyclacel said: “Available data from our ongoing Phase 2 studies of sapacitabine include complete remissions at all doses tested with good tolerability, which support previously-reported Phase 1 findings and suggest that this agent may address a substantial, unmet medical need in older patients with AML and MDS."On February 6th 2009, Cyclacel Pharmaceuticals announced a fast-track agreement with the U.S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for a Phase II test planned for sapacitabine. Piper Jaffray has a $3 price target on the stock.

Cytokinetics (CYTK): Early Tuesday morning, Cytokinetics announced that mega-biotech company Amgen (AMGN) would be paying Cytokinetics $50 million dollars as part of an option to exercise rights to one of Cytokinetics key heart drugs: ‘CK-1827452’. Currently the $50 million dollar payment represents almost 1/3rd of Cytokinetic’s current market capitalization. Under the official agreements will pay Cytokinetics a non-refundable fee of $50 million and future performance-based payments of up to $600 million.

Exelixis (EXEL): Recent interim results from Exelixis and Bristol-Myers Squibb (BMY) have shown to shrink brain tumors is some patients suffering with advance forms of brain cancer. From the early stage data, 10 out of the 46 patients, or 36 percent of all patients reported a 50 percent or more shrinkage, with 1 patient reporting a 100 percent reduction in tumor size.
